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
721968628 44728 6760946 45193
7187725 47772840
7187725 47772840
120 0245429 3018402 200 250
All about undefined
Interested in learning more?
7187725 47772840
120 0245429 3018402 200 250
See more
6937 8958014756 4448
51888385 75 82 34989077 194699
See more
616 74243855 0732237159
61115236951 674703 456
See more